About Australian Christian College
Australian Christian College (ACC) is a faith-based, non-denominational education provider focused on nurturing students spiritually, academically, socially, and physically to reach their fullest potential and positively impact the wider community. The institution prides itself on delivering excellent education through skilled and dedicated Christian educators.
ACC operates under Christian Education Ministries with 17 campuses across five Australian states and stands as the foremost non-government distance education provider nationwide.
ACC Victoria Online
Situated at the ACC Casey campus in Cranbourne South, ACC Victoria Online offers remote learning from Year 5 to Year 11 starting in 2026.
